What Is the Glycemic Index and Why Does It Matter?
The glycemic index (GI) reflects how much a specific food raises blood glucose levels from ingestion to two hours after consumption, relative to the equivalent amount of pure glucose (which has a GI of 100). This measurement system helps people with diabetes understand which foods are more likely to cause rapid spikes in blood sugar versus those that provide a more gradual, controlled release of glucose into the bloodstream.
For anyone watching their blood sugar, the GI of a specific food is close to the top priority when considering what to eat because the lower a food’s GI, the less overall risk they take of having elevated blood sugar as a result of eating it. Foods are generally classified into three categories: low GI (55 or less), medium GI (56-69), and high GI (70 or above). Low GI foods are particularly beneficial for diabetics as they help maintain more stable blood glucose levels throughout the day.
The Glycemic Profile of Yogurt: A Closer Look
The 93 GI values for yogurt in the University of Sydney’s GI database have a mean ± SD of 34 ± 13, and 92% of the yogurts are low-GI (≤55). This makes yogurt an excellent choice for individuals concerned about blood sugar management. High yogurt intake is associated with a reduced risk of type 2 diabetes (T2DM).
The low glycemic nature of yogurt can be attributed to several factors, including its protein content, fat composition, and the fermentation process. During the fermentation process, lactic acid is formed, and it may reduce glycemic response by slowing gastric emptying. Additionally, the varying amounts of fat and protein, nutrients which are known to reduce glycemic response, could also play a role, with protein content showing stronger effect on lowering glycemic response than fat.
Understanding the Insulinemic Index
While the glycemic index is important, it’s not the complete picture. The insulinemic index (II), which measures insulin response, is substantially higher than the glycemic index in yogurt. This means that while yogurt doesn’t cause significant blood sugar spikes, it does trigger a notable insulin response. However, overall high yogurt consumption is still associated with a lower risk of type 2 diabetes mellitus, suggesting that this insulin response may not be problematic in the context of yogurt consumption.
Plain Yogurt vs. Flavored Yogurt: The Critical Differences
The distinction between plain and flavored yogurt is crucial for individuals managing diabetes. The 43 plain yogurts in the database have a lower GI than the 50 sweetened yogurts, 27 ± 11 compared with 41 ± 11 (P < 0.0001). While both types fall within the low GI category, this difference can have meaningful implications for blood sugar control.
The Protein-to-Carbohydrate Ratio
This difference is not explained by sugar, per se, but rather by the higher protein-to-carbohydrate ratio in plain yogurt. Sweetened yogurts contain about 2.5 times more carbohydrate per 100g than plain yogurts. This means that when equal amounts of carbohydrates are consumed, plain yogurt provides significantly more protein, which helps moderate the blood glucose response.
Added Sugars in Flavored Yogurt
Flavored yogurts contain 15-25 grams of sugar per serving, often due to added sugar, which causes a spike in glucose levels in the blood. These added sugars can come from various sources including cane sugar, fruit concentrates, syrups, and preserves. Fruit and other flavored yogurts contain extra amounts of cane sugar, fruit concentrations, or syrups.
Even yogurts marketed as healthy options may contain problematic amounts of added sugar. Even the ‘low-fat’ varieties contain more sugar than the regular varieties to compensate for the lack of fat, which complicates the full-fat vs. low-fat discussion. This is an important consideration, as many people assume that low-fat automatically means healthier for diabetes management.
Greek Yogurt: A Superior Choice for Diabetics
Greek yogurt has emerged as a particularly beneficial option for individuals with diabetes. Greek yogurt is produced normally then strained to remove lactose and liquid milk proteins, which has the overall effect of raising the fat-to-carbohydrate ratio. This straining process creates a product with distinct nutritional advantages.
Unsweetened Greek yogurt can contain up to twice the protein and half the carbohydrates of regular yogurt. 100g of full-fat Greek yogurt has 9 grams of protein and 3.96 grams of carbohydrates compared to just 3.47 grams of protein and 4.66 carbohydrates in full-fat traditional yogurt. This superior protein-to-carbohydrate ratio makes Greek yogurt an excellent choice for blood sugar management.
Greek yogurt has a low glycemic index and load, providing steady energy without causing blood sugar spikes. Some sources report the glycemic index of Greek yogurt to be as low as 11, making it one of the lowest GI dairy products available. The protein and fat content help slow down digestion, reducing the insulin response.
The Role of Probiotics in Diabetes Management
Beyond their glycemic impact, yogurts containing live and active cultures offer additional benefits for individuals with diabetes. In a population of overweight and obese patients with T2DM, consumption of probiotic yogurt caused a significant decrease in HbA1C levels, an indirect measure of long-term blood glucose levels.
There is a strong relationship between an individual’s microbiome composition and their metabolic health, with those having a higher diversity of healthy bugs in their gut showing better controlled glucose levels and lower rates of diabetes. The probiotics in yogurt can help support this beneficial gut microbiome diversity.
Greek yogurt contains probiotics, which are beneficial for gut health. When selecting yogurt for its probiotic benefits, it’s advisable to opt for those with live and active cultures to maximize probiotic benefits. The fermentation process that creates these beneficial bacteria is also partly responsible for yogurt’s favorable glycemic properties.
How to Read Yogurt Labels for Diabetes Management
Navigating the yogurt aisle can be overwhelming, but understanding how to read nutrition labels is essential for making diabetes-friendly choices. Here are the key factors to examine:
Total Carbohydrates and Added Sugars
Yogurts that contain a total carbohydrate content of 15 g or less per serving are ideal for people with diabetes. It’s crucial to distinguish between total sugars and added sugars on the nutrition label. When looking at the label on a yogurt container, check the amount of added sugar rather than total sugar content, with a safe choice being a yogurt with no more than 5 grams of added sugar per container per serving.
Choose options that contain 10 grams (g) of sugar or less. Natural sugars from lactose will always be present in dairy yogurt, but added sugars are what primarily drive up the glycemic impact and should be minimized or avoided entirely.
Protein Content
Protein is one of the most important nutrients for blood sugar regulation because it slows down digestion, slowing the release of sugar into your bloodstream, and increases insulin secretion, which helps your cells absorb blood sugar. When looking for a blood sugar-friendly yogurt, aim for 10 grams or more of protein.
Higher protein yogurts not only help with blood sugar management but also promote satiety, which can help with weight management—another important factor in diabetes control. A high-protein, low-sugar yogurt can lead to reduced hunger, increased fullness and ultimately, decreased caloric intake — all of which can play an integral part in weight loss and blood glucose stability.
Fat Content Considerations
The debate between full-fat and low-fat yogurt continues in nutrition science. Whole milk yogurt has a more favorable GI, with the fat content of the yogurt further aiding the glycemic index profile of the food, which is good for keeping blood glucose levels within a manageable range.
Fat can help slow the digestion of carbohydrates and their conversion into sugar after eating, keeping blood sugar levels lower after meals. When choosing yogurt, it’s best to avoid low-fat versions — they often come with added sugars, while having full-fat yogurt also helps you feel fuller for longer.

Plant-Based Yogurt Alternatives for Diabetics
For individuals who are lactose intolerant, vegan, or simply prefer plant-based options, there are several dairy-free yogurt alternatives available. However, these require careful selection as their nutritional profiles can vary significantly from dairy yogurt.
Soy-Based Yogurt
Soy milk is a better option with a balanced content of protein and other macros, making unsweetened versions a potential low-sugar yogurt for a diabetes alternative. Soy yogurt typically provides the closest nutritional profile to dairy yogurt in terms of protein content.
Other Plant-Based Options
Almond milk and coconut milk contain little protein and may contain added sugar. Plant-based yogurts often don’t contain the high protein-to-sugar ratio of dairy yogurt, so don’t provide the same nutritional benefits. When choosing plant-based yogurts, look for options that have been fortified with protein and contain no added sugars.

FDA Recognition and Diabetes Prevention
The Food and Drug Administration (FDA) recently decided to allow yogurt manufacturers to say that eating at least 2 cups of yogurt per week may reduce the risk of developing diabetes. This recognition is based on substantial scientific evidence showing the protective effects of regular yogurt consumption.
Research from Harvard School of Public Health shows that people who eat one serving of yogurt daily have an 18% lower risk of developing type 2 diabetes. While the exact mechanisms are still being studied, the combination of protein, probiotics, calcium, and the low glycemic nature of yogurt all likely contribute to this protective effect.

The Science Behind Yogurt’s Protective Effects
Researchers have proposed several mechanisms to explain why yogurt consumption is associated with reduced diabetes risk and better blood sugar control:
Gut Microbiome Modulation
Yogurt’s probiotics support gut health, which emerging research links to better blood sugar control, with a healthy gut microbiome potentially reducing inflammation and improving how your body processes carbohydrates. The diversity and composition of gut bacteria have been shown to influence insulin sensitivity and glucose metabolism.
Hormonal Responses
Consuming yogurt is associated with increased levels of two compounds, called glucagon-like peptide 1 and peptide YY, which both reduce appetite and influence glucose metabolism. These hormones play important roles in regulating blood sugar and promoting satiety.
Weight Management
A few studies suggest that yogurt is associated with reduced weight gain. Since obesity is a major risk factor for type 2 diabetes, yogurt’s potential role in weight management may contribute to its protective effects. However, some studies looking at yogurt and diabetes accounted for body mass index (BMI) in their analyses, with yogurt still being associated with a lower risk of diabetes regardless of participants’ BMI, meaning body weight can’t be the whole story.
Common Myths and Misconceptions About Yogurt and Diabetes
Myth 1: All Yogurt Is Equally Healthy
Reality: The nutritional profile of yogurt varies dramatically between products. Some varieties are packed with protein and healthy fats with little sugar, while others cram in more sugar than ice cream. Always read labels carefully and choose plain, unsweetened varieties.
Myth 2: Fruit Yogurt Counts as a Fruit Serving
Reality: Most fruit-flavored yogurts contain minimal actual fruit and are primarily sweetened with added sugars and fruit concentrates. The small amount of fruit present doesn’t provide the same nutritional benefits as whole fruit.
Myth 3: Low-Fat Is Always Better for Diabetics
Reality: Low-fat yogurts often contain more added sugar to compensate for flavor, and the fat in full-fat yogurt can actually help slow carbohydrate absorption and improve satiety. The best choice depends on individual health goals and should be discussed with a healthcare provider.
Myth 4: Artificial Sweeteners Make Yogurt Safe for Diabetics
Reality: New research is leading experts to advise caution with artificial sweeteners, especially for people with diabetes and insulin resistance, as recent research suggests that artificial sweeteners may actually promote weight gain and changes in gut bacteria.
